REQUIREMENTS

Key Requirements:

  • Preference for lawyers with fluent English and Mandarin capabilities, including reading, speaking, and writing both Simplified and Traditional Mandarin.
  • Experience with taking witness statements preferred.
  • Experience with document discovery or investigations is helpful, but training is provided.
  • Proficient in the use of modern technology, including proficiency in Microsoft Office suite, particularly Excel.
  • Critical thinking skills and ability to retain complex work direction.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.

This position is only open to Malaysian citizens.

Responsibilities:

Key Responsibilities:

  • preparing interview questions and documentation
  • review matter materials, assess issues that may fall within the ambit of the investigation
  • interviewing individuals, including sometimes non-cooperative ones
  • preparing written minutes and interview notes
  • drafting interview memorandums and reports, investigation report and email summary
  • reviewing large quantities of documents accurately and efficiently;
  • identifying key information and effectively communicating findings to other team members and your review manager; and
  • collaborating with the review manager and your team members to meet critical deadlines.
  • recognizing patterns in the data to allow for consistent coding of similar documents in larger quantities; and
  • being able to multi-task and work on multiple projects, as needed.
  • raising questions and issues in a timely manner to the team
